Why bother getting credit for an internship?
• If you register, you are protected by the university’s liability insurance (one million dollars per “occurrence”). • The main university document showing you did an internship is a transcript with ELang 399R on it. We strongly recommend that you sign up for at least one credit so that you will have this official record. When should I start doing internships? Ideally, you should plan your editing minor so that you are ready for an internship in your junior year. Many entry-level editing positions require a year or more of experience. If you do two years of part-time internships, you can meet that requirement. Will I be paid during my internship? Some but not all internships are paid. An intern may do an internship for credit only. However, some sites will hire an intern after a semester of working for credit alone. Can editing a book for someone count as an internship?
